WrayneI've been asked a couple times why a couple people haven't been able to sign up for an Operation or other event. One thing of note is that you must have actually created a "Character" in your profile to be able to sign up for these events. We do this so that people with lots of alts, *ahem* merc *ahem* can very easily specify who they wish to take to the event.

After the success of last Friday's open ops run we're looking to start working on forming a Friday night ops team. This week's 6:00 server run will still be open, and certainly feel free to sign up on the Redeemed website events calendar even if the run looks full. Please show up at least 15 minutes early for group formup, we may get off just a little bit late as we will have a short discussion of what we're looking for in a team, although I'll make some points in this post.
1) We are not looking necessarily for just 8 people for the team. People have a lot of events to attend to on Friday nights and there will always be some variation in spots. 100% attendance is certainly not expected on Friday nights. Please sign up if interested, even if it looks like we'll have some overlapping roles--this may not be the only team forming, and if we have enough people we may run 16 man operations. We will just have to see how this develops.
2) This group is open to beginners, we expect to be running normal modes until patch 1.2 at this point. If you are a beginner, becoming active in running hard modes is a great way to prepare for operations. A number of us run them most evenings, and are quite happy to help new people learn and adjust.
3) There will be some minimum gear requirements to run in Team Bacon. A full set of the appropriate level 50 barrels/hilts, armorings, mods, and enhancements will be required in modable slots. Your other items should at least be level 50 blues or above--speak to our crafters in the guild if you need help, and many items are available on the GTN for reasonable enough prices if you are running dailies (you make about 200k just running them each day). If you're interested in the team, still show up on Friday even if you haven't met these requirements yet.
4) If you are running an operation for the first time, please be considerate of your other team members and watch videos of the encounters beforehand. It is best to find some (often on youtube) that offer fight explanations. If people haven't watched the videos, we have to spend more time explaining fights and answering basic questions when we could be actually playing and/or going more into strategy.
5) While not a "requirement" as such, we strongly recommend you talk to other 50s in the guild of your advanced class and read guides in our forums and elsewhere to learn how to better play your class in endgame--everyone always has more they can learn.
